Serious Adverse Events (SAEs) are adverse events that result in death, are life-threatening, require or prolong hospitalization, cause persistent or significant disability/incapacity, or are congenital anomalies/birth defects. Each serious event is categorized by term, organ system, assessment type, and source vocabulary to provide standardized reporting across clinical trials.
